ZIP 65305 has notably lower household income than the US average, with a median household income of $54,267. Population has held roughly steady since 2024. 49%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. At a median age of 22.3, residents skew younger than the country as a whole. 49% of adults hold a bachelor's degree, well above the US average, yet household income trails the national figure — a profile common to graduate-student tracts and academic hubs. Among the 8 ZIP codes in Johnson County, 65305 ranks 8th by median household income.

How many people live in ZIP code 65305?

ZIP code 65305 has about 3,445 residents according to the 2024 American Community Survey.

What is the median household income in ZIP code 65305?

The typical household in ZIP code 65305 earns about $54,267 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is ZIP code 65305 expensive?

In ZIP code 65305, the typical rent is about $1,306 a month.

How educated are people in ZIP code 65305?

About 48.6% of adults age 25 and over in ZIP code 65305 h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in ZIP code 65305?

About 13.6% of people in ZIP code 65305 live below the federal poverty line.
